Engineering Teachers, Postsecondary
SOC Code: 25-1032
The DOL disclosure extract lists 169 H-1B LCA filings for Engineering Teachers, Postsecondary from 24 employer filers, with a 97% DOL certification rate and an average listed offered wage of $101,243. The highest-volume worksite state is MI with 81 filings. The highest-volume filer is University of Michigan. These filings are not USCIS petition approvals or visa outcomes.
LCA filing profile: Engineering Teachers, Postsecondary. Under U.S. Department of Labor standard occupational classification 25-1032, the extract lists 169 Labor Condition Application filings from 24 distinct employer filers. The DOL certified 97% of those filings, a DOL record status for the wage and working-condition attestations. Filing volume does not establish that a role qualifies for H-1B, that a USCIS petition was filed or approved, or that anyone was hired.

About This Data
Labor Condition Application (LCA) filing data is sourced from the U.S. Department of Labor (DOL) disclosure files. Data covers fiscal years 2023 through 2026. Salary figures reflect amounts listed on LCA filings, not actual compensation paid or USCIS petition outcomes.

Does an LCA filing establish H-1B eligibility for Engineering Teachers, Postsecondary?
No. A listed LCA filing does not establish that a role or an individual qualifies for H-1B, and it does not establish USCIS approval. Eligibility depends on the specific petition and facts; consult qualified immigration counsel for case-specific guidance.
